Five pan sizes, two lids

Each pan in this set is made from titanium and finished with a hammered surface texture. No coating is applied to the interior, so food meets the titanium layer itself. The sizes run from 20 cm for eggs and sauces up to 30 cm for larger portions.

Why You'll Love It
• Material: titanium body with a hammered surface texture
• Set contents: pans of 20 cm (8 inch), 23 cm (9 inch), 25 cm (10 inch), 28 cm (11 inch) and 30 cm (12 inch)
• Lids included: one lid for the 20 cm pan and one lid for the 30 cm pan
• Uncoated interior: no PTFE or PFOA in the cooking layer
• Hob compatibility: suitable for gas, induction, electric and oven use

Coated pans wear down with use, which is why they are usually replaced after a few years.

Coatings Wear Over Time

A non stick coating is a surface layer applied over the pan base. With regular use at high heat that layer wears down and can flake, which is why coated pans are usually replaced after a few years.

Utensil Restrictions

Coated pans normally come with the instruction to use wooden or silicone utensils. Metal spatulas and tongs can mark the coating, so the surface needs care during everyday cooking.

Uneven Heat Across the Base

A thin pan base heats up faster in the centre than at the edges. That difference in temperature across the surface shows up when you sear or fry at higher heat.

  • No PTFE or PFOA in the Cooking LayerThe cooking layer is titanium and contains no PTFE, no PFOA and no applied non stick coating. There is no sprayed surface film between the food and the metal.
  • Uncoated Titanium Cooking SurfaceThe cooking surface is titanium rather than a coating applied over aluminium. It has a textured hammered finish and is used with a small amount of oil or butter.
  • Suitable for Hob and OvenThe pan body and the riveted stainless steel handle are made to go from the hob into the oven. Suitable for gas, induction, electric and ceramic hobs.
  • Multi Layer BaseA multi layer base sits underneath the titanium surface and spreads heat across the width of the pan. The base is flat, so it sits level on induction and ceramic hobs.

The cooking layer is titanium instead of a non stick coating applied over aluminium. It contains no PTFE and no PFOA, and there is no sprayed surface film. Food release depends on preheating the pan gently and using a small amount of oil or butter.

The cooking surface is uncoated titanium with a hammered finish. Underneath it sits a multi layer base that spreads heat across the width of the pan. The handle is stainless steel and is riveted to the body.

Yes. The surface is uncoated titanium, so metal, wooden and silicone utensils can all be used. On coated pans, wooden or silicone utensils are usually advised instead.

The pans are suitable for gas, induction, electric and ceramic hobs, and they can also go into the oven. The base is flat, which is what an induction hob needs in order to make contact.

Yes, the pans are dishwasher safe. Hand washing with warm water and a soft sponge is also suitable. Dry the pan after washing before you put it away.

No seasoning step is needed. Rinse and dry the pan before first use, then heat it gently and add a small amount of oil or butter before the food goes in.
